How We Rate Casinos
At Patrick Carmichael, we evaluate non-UK casinos using a comprehensive methodology to help British players find trustworthy and entertaining gambling sites. Our ratings are independent, transparent, and based on rigorous testing and research.
1. Licensing & Regulation
We prioritise casinos with legitimate licensing from recognised international authorities. This is our most important criterion, as proper regulation ensures player protection and fair play. We look for licences from:
- MGA (Malta Gaming Authority) β Strict European standards
- CuraΓ§ao eGaming β Well-established offshore licensing
- UKGC (UK Gambling Commission) β Where available
- Other reputable local jurisdictional licences
Casinos without verifiable licensing receive significantly lower ratings, regardless of other merits.
2. Game Selection & Software Providers
We assess the variety and quality of gaming content. This includes:
- Slot Games β Range, themes, and RTP percentages
- Live Casino β Live dealers, table variety, streaming quality
- Table Games β Blackjack, roulette, baccarat, poker variants
- Software Providers β Partnerships with industry leaders (NetEnt, Microgaming, Pragmatic Play, etc.)
Casinos offering diverse, well-sourced games from reputable developers score higher.
3. Bonus Terms & Wagering Requirements
We thoroughly review promotional offers and their conditions:
- Terms & Conditions β Clarity, fairness, and transparency
- Wagering Requirements β Rollover multipliers and achievability
- Maximum Cashout Limits β Restrictions on bonus winnings
- Game Contribution Rates β Which games count toward wagering
- Bonus Validity Period β Time limits on claims and completion
We flag casinos with excessive requirements or hidden restrictions in their T&Cs.
4. Payment Methods & Withdrawal Speed
We evaluate the accessibility and efficiency of banking options:
- Deposit Methods β Cryptocurrencies, e-wallets (PayPal, Skrill, Neteller), bank transfers, card payments
- Withdrawal Speed β Processing times and reliability
- Transaction Fees β Hidden charges or fair pricing
- Supported Currencies β GBP and other major currencies
- Limits β Minimum and maximum transaction amounts
Fast, flexible payment options with no hidden fees score higher.
5. Customer Support
We test and rate the quality of player support services:
- 24/7 Live Chat β Availability and response times
- Email Support β Response quality and turnaround time
- Phone Support β Where available
- Knowledge Base β FAQ and help documentation
- Staff Responsiveness β Helpfulness and problem resolution
Casinos with readily available, knowledgeable support receive higher ratings.
6. Mobile Experience
We assess the quality of mobile gaming across devices and platforms:
- Responsive Design β Website functionality on smartphones and tablets
- Dedicated Apps β iOS and Android applications where offered
- Game Performance β Loading speed and visual quality on mobile
- Navigation β Ease of use and intuitive interface
- Feature Parity β Mobile access to all desktop features
Seamless, optimised mobile experiences are highly valued by our reviewers.
7. Responsible Gaming Tools
We prioritise casinos that implement player protection measures:
- Deposit Limits β Daily, weekly, or monthly spending caps
- Loss Limits β Restrictions on maximum losses
- Session Timers β Automatic play reminders and breaks
- Self-Exclusion β Easy access to temporary or permanent account suspension
- Cooling-Off Period β Mandatory pause before reactivation
- Gambling Awareness β Links to support organisations (GamCare, BeGambleAware)
Casinos with comprehensive responsible gaming options receive higher ratings, as player safety is paramount.
8. Our Rating Scale
We rate casinos on a scale of 1 to 10, with the following breakdown:
- 9-10 (Excellent) β Top-tier casinos meeting all criteria with exceptional service
- 7-8 (Very Good) β Strong performance across most categories with minor areas for improvement
- 5-6 (Good) β Solid casinos with some strengths but notable weaknesses
- 3-4 (Fair) β Casinos with significant concerns, including questionable licensing or poor terms
- 1-2 (Poor) β Casinos we cannot recommend due to serious issues or lack of regulation
Important: A casino must have verifiable licensing to receive a rating above 3. No amount of bonuses or games can compensate for regulatory concerns.
